Pontiac Bonneville Engine And Engine Cooling Engine Safety Report | Feb 24, 2000



Reported on Feb 24, 2000


A BELL SOUNDS AND ENGINE SHUTS OFF. NO POWER AT ALL, CAUSING VERY DANGEROUS CONDITION. HAD TO DEALER 5 TIMES, AND CRANK SENSOR REPLACED, ALONG WITH COMPUTER. CONDITION STILL EXISTS WHICH COULD CAUSE POSSIABLE ACCIDENT WITH SERIOUS INJURY OR DEATH.*AK
